If you're entertaining thoughts of becoming an online entrepreneur and have visions of money flooding in while you lounge around a swimming pool with your laptop, you should think again. It usually doesn't work out that way, but it is possible. The fact that it is a home-based business does not always mean that things happen as easily as some may have you believe. Once you are promised a huge return almost instantly, turn the other way.

Some people do achieve that kind of success, but it would be foolish to expect exactly the same for yourself. It is really appealing to leave the annoying employer and the dead end job, but becoming an entrepreneur of a web-based enterprise, working at home, has its own set of difficulties. Working from your home does give you the liberty to wear what you like and work the hours you choose. Working from home does have many advantages, but it often can be a rough ride. The risk attached to web-based enterprises is no different from offline, though they might not require as much seed money. Don't be frightened off, but keep in mind you may well lose a few things along the way.

It could mean that they must put up with a period of financial hardship, but many online entrepreneurs resign from their jobs eventually. There isn't any guarantee that your business will be a success, immediately, or even a success by any means. You might well spend a lot before seeing your cash flow turn positive, so this is something you must accept straight up. One thing, however, if your Internet business works well for you, any deficits you suffer through will be insignificant compared to the gains you'll make, because of the risks you are prepared to take. The fixed revenue stream you were getting before beginning your business, which is no longer there, is a great financial risk. This can mean joy at the end, or despair if you let it destroy your business.

You'll find risks in any enterprise, considering that even the biggest establishments sometimes don't succeed. It requires a different mindset to own your own venture, because you won't have that same fixed earnings you were accustomed to. Some months you will make lots of money, while in others you may make nothing at all. Put together a budget, so that you could cover your deficits in the poor months with savings from the fantastic months. Perhaps you're not the born entrepreneur after all, and the 9 to 5 routine that brings in a regular paycheck is not really that bad.

Becoming an entrepreneur is hard work, but when you stay with it, you are going to be delighted you did. In the beginning there is a great deal of effort necessary, but in the long run the payoff is good.
